SOP Format for University of Michigan

While the exact word limit varies by department, most UMich graduate programs expect:

  • Length: 1–2 pages (700–1000 words)
  • Font: Standard (Times New Roman / Arial, 11–12 pt)
  • Spacing: 1.0 or 1.5
  • File Type: PDF unless otherwise mentioned

Always double-check your specific program page, because some departments provide additional prompts or sub-questions.

How to Structure an SOP for the University of Michigan

Here is the perfect structure followed by top applicants:

1. Introduction – Who You Are & Your Academic Direction

A compelling introduction should include:

  • Your current academic status
  • Your field of interest
  • A brief overview of what led you to this field
  • Your motivation for pursuing the program

Make it crisp, not dramatic.


2. Academic Background

Highlight:

  • Undergraduate degree
  • Key courses
  • Academic achievements
  • Projects or seminars
  • Internships related to your field

Show how your past learning built your foundation.


3. Research Experience (Very Important for UMich)

Michigan is a research-heavy university. So mention:

  • Research projects
  • Labs you worked in
  • Tools, methods, or frameworks used
  • Publications (if any)
  • Skills gained through research

This section increases your chances significantly.


4. Work Experience (If applicable)

Share:

  • Roles and responsibilities
  • Technical or managerial skills
  • Outcomes or results
  • How it connects with your program goals

Be concise and impact-focused.


5. Why University of Michigan? (The Key Section)

This must be program-specific, not generic.

Mention:

  • Faculty whose research aligns with your interest
  • Lab groups, centers, or initiatives
  • Projects or coursework unique to Michigan
  • How these match your academic goals

This shows the committee that you’re serious and informed.


6. Career Goals

UMich wants students who have clarity.

Explain:

  • Short-term goals (2–3 years after graduation)
  • Long-term goals (where you see yourself in 7–10 years)
  • The kind of impact you want to create

Keep it realistic and focused.


7. Conclusion

End your SOP with:

  • A quick summary of your vision
  • Why you’re a strong fit
  • Your enthusiasm for contributing to the university

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) – SOP for University of Michigan

1. What does the University of Michigan expect from an SOP?
The University of Michigan expects an academically focused SOP that highlights your preparation, research interest, relevant coursework, skills, and alignment with the program’s goals and faculty.
2. What is the ideal word count for the University of Michigan SOP?
Most programs accept 500–1000 words. Some departments have fixed limits, so always refer to the official program page for accurate guidelines before writing.
3. Should I include faculty names in my Michigan SOP?
Yes. Mention 1–2 professors whose research aligns with your academic interest. This shows clarity, purpose, and strong academic direction — especially for research-heavy programs.
4. Can I discuss personal struggles or emotional stories in my SOP?
Only if they influenced your academic journey. The University of Michigan prefers an academically driven SOP instead of personal or emotional storytelling.
5. Can I use one SOP for multiple U.S. universities including Michigan?
Not advisable. Michigan looks for a program-specific and research-aligned SOP. A generic SOP decreases your admission chances significantly.
6. Does Michigan check for plagiarism or AI-written SOPs?
Yes. Michigan uses strict plagiarism detection tools and expects original, human-written content. Avoid templates, AI-generated generic writing, or copied samples.
7. How important is research experience for University of Michigan admissions?
For STEM and PhD programs, it is extremely important. For Master’s programs, internships, projects, and professional experience also carry strong value.
8. Should I write different SOPs for Michigan’s Master’s and PhD programs?
Yes. A PhD SOP must focus heavily on research, publications, academic depth, and faculty alignment. A Master’s SOP can be more balanced between academics, career goals, and relevant experience.
